Skip to content

Commit 74860ff

Browse files
authored
test: add LastTransition to fix test (#4132)
1 parent e36183d commit 74860ff

File tree

1 file changed

+12
-12
lines changed

1 file changed

+12
-12
lines changed

ray-operator/controllers/ray/rayjob_controller_test.go

Lines changed: 12 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-2147,7 +2147,7 @@ var _ = Context("RayJob with different submission modes", func() {
21472147

21482148
// Update the submitter Kubernetes Job to Complete.
21492149
conditions := []batchv1.JobCondition{
2150-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
2150+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
21512151
}
21522152
job.Status.Conditions = conditions
21532153
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-2304,7 +2304,7 @@ var _ = Context("RayJob with different submission modes", func() {
23042304

23052305
// Update the submitter Kubernetes Job to Complete.
23062306
conditions := []batchv1.JobCondition{
2307-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
2307+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
23082308
}
23092309
job.Status.Conditions = conditions
23102310
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-2461,7 +2461,7 @@ var _ = Context("RayJob with different submission modes", func() {
24612461

24622462
// Update the submitter Kubernetes Job to Complete.
24632463
conditions := []batchv1.JobCondition{
2464-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
2464+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
24652465
}
24662466
job.Status.Conditions = conditions
24672467
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-2601,7 +2601,7 @@ var _ = Context("RayJob with different submission modes", func() {
26012601

26022602
// Update the submitter Kubernetes Job to Complete.
26032603
conditions := []batchv1.JobCondition{
2604-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
2604+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
26052605
}
26062606
job.Status.Conditions = conditions
26072607
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-2727,7 +2727,7 @@ var _ = Context("RayJob with different submission modes", func() {
27272727

27282728
// Update the submitter Kubernetes Job to Complete.
27292729
conditions := []batchv1.JobCondition{
2730-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
2730+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
27312731
}
27322732
job.Status.Conditions = conditions
27332733
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-2842,7 +2842,7 @@ var _ = Context("RayJob with different submission modes", func() {
28422842

28432843
// Update the submitter Kubernetes Job to Complete.
28442844
conditions := []batchv1.JobCondition{
2845-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
2845+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
28462846
}
28472847
job.Status.Conditions = conditions
28482848
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-2971,7 +2971,7 @@ var _ = Context("RayJob with different submission modes", func() {
29712971

29722972
// Update the submitter Kubernetes Job to Complete.
29732973
conditions := []batchv1.JobCondition{
2974-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
2974+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
29752975
}
29762976
job.Status.Conditions = conditions
29772977
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-3133,7 +3133,7 @@ var _ = Context("RayJob with different submission modes", func() {
31333133

31343134
// Update the submitter Kubernetes Job to Complete.
31353135
conditions := []batchv1.JobCondition{
3136-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
3136+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
31373137
}
31383138
job.Status.Conditions = conditions
31393139
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-3325,7 +3325,7 @@ var _ = Context("RayJob with different submission modes", func() {
33253325

33263326
// Update the submitter Kubernetes Job to Complete.
33273327
conditions := []batchv1.JobCondition{
3328-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
3328+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
33293329
}
33303330
job.Status.Conditions = conditions
33313331
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-3484,7 +3484,7 @@ var _ = Context("RayJob with different submission modes", func() {
34843484

34853485
// Update the submitter Kubernetes Job to Complete.
34863486
conditions := []batchv1.JobCondition{
3487-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
3487+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
34883488
}
34893489
job.Status.Conditions = conditions
34903490
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-3644,7 +3644,7 @@ var _ = Context("RayJob with different submission modes", func() {
36443644

36453645
// Update the submitter Kubernetes Job to Complete.
36463646
conditions := []batchv1.JobCondition{
3647-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
3647+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
36483648
}
36493649
job.Status.Conditions = conditions
36503650
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())
@@ -3852,7 +3852,7 @@ var _ = Context("RayJob with different submission modes", func() {
38523852

38533853
// Update the submitter Kubernetes Job to Complete.
38543854
conditions := []batchv1.JobCondition{
3855-
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ue},
3855+
{Type: batchv1.JobComplete, Status: corev1.ConditionTrue, LastTransitionTime: metav1.Now()},
38563856
}
38573857
job.Status.Conditions = conditions
38583858
Expect(k8sClient.Status().Update(ctx, job)).Should(Succeed())

0 commit comments

Comments
 (0)